Technical Advisor Africa

Open | South Africa


An opportunity exists in the Projects Department for a Technical Advisor for the Africa region. Position key tasks and duties include Sales, Projects, Inspections, After-Sales, Servicing of existing Clients and Acquisition of New Clients.


More on this job

Categories: Chutes Crusher - Parts 


2024-07-15 | Weba Chute Systems | South Africa | Views 101

More from Weba Chute Systems
Weba Optimise Tran...
Weba Chutes - Redu...
Weba Chutes - Qual...
Weba Chute Systems
Weba chute systems